That's a killer build! FWIW, my Strange pro-iron case rusted the first time it saw humidity. If you want it to stay pretty, plan on painting it.

how wide is the housing (flange to flange)? Killer build btw!!

I don't remember off the top of my head. Its S&W's 28" wide rear frame package with back braced 9" housing. I'll see if I can get a measurement for you tomorrow.
 
I'd appreciate that! I have a narrowed backbraced 9"/ alston ladder bar rear that I'm hoping to use in the future.
 
how wide is the housing (flange to flange)? Killer build btw!!

The axle is 38 1/2" wide from flange to flange. The Frame is 28" outside to outside. The system is made for a 14" wheel with 4" backspace.
